To: Finance Team
Re: Q2 Cash-Flow Forecast

The quarterly forecast shows net operating inflows of 4.1m, down from the 4.6m projected in January. The shortfall stems from delayed receivables on the Branwell contract and higher logistics costs at the Orlip depot. Payables remain on schedule. We expect the gap to close by week nine, assuming the Kessler invoice clears as planned.

No changes to the credit facility are required this quarter. Treasury will recirculate assumptions Friday.

Please read the note below before the forecast review.

management briefing: Sorvanox Systems plans to raise the Zorwyn list price by 27.2 percent in December. The pricing group signed off on a budget of $101.7 million for Project Casox. The renewal with Pramirix Foods closes at $183.4 million a year, 63.5 percent above the last contract. Project Holdor slips by one quarter because of the tooling delay.

Step 4: Register your event schemas with the Lattice registry before the Ordway consumers can read your topic. Use the CLI, not the web console — the console lags on compatibility checks. Backward compatibility is enforced; breaking changes require a new subject. Run the validator locally first to save a round trip. Point the CLI at the staging registry using these values.

deployment values, kajep-kageg:
[praix]
host = praix.paliqcorp.corp
user = praix_svc
database = praix_prod

**VramScope quick fix — support team**

If a customer's VramScope traces come back empty, the profiler daemon on their Tessellate node probably can't reach the collector. Have them restart the `vramscoped` service first; nine times out of ten that clears it. If not, they'll need to regenerate their collector credentials in the Tessellate console and drop them into `/etc/vramscope/.env`. The file needs exactly one line added:

secret setting of tawif-tajop: COURIER_KEY13=819c65d82d2bd

## Artifact Signing — SpoolHawk Service

All SpoolHawk printer-spooler builds must be signed before promotion to the Veldrin staging ring. Unsigned artifacts are rejected by the Corvex gatekeeper with error SPG-41. Support: if a customer reports a blocked spooler update, verify the build hash against the signing manifest first. Do not re-queue unsigned jobs. Signing runs on the Harlo build node only. For emergency verification, use the key below.

signing key of bagap-yawep = bky13_TbfT6ZMUoGJo2